Conversion table
| kn | ft/s |
|---|---|
| 1 kn | 1.6878 ft/s |
| 2 kn | 3.3756 ft/s |
| 5 kn | 8.439 ft/s |
| 10 kn | 16.8781 ft/s |
| 25 kn | 42.1952 ft/s |
| 50 kn | 84.3905 ft/s |
| 100 kn | 168.781 ft/s |

Formula, assumptions, and example
result = input × 0.5144444444 ÷ 0.3048
Assumptions
- Knots and Feet per second represent the same speed quantity.
- The input is expressed in kn; the output is expressed in ft/s.
- Mach uses 343 m/s, a representative dry-air value near 20 °C.
1 kn = 1.68780985696 ft/s. For another value, apply the same relationship and round only to the precision your source measurement supports.
